Apartment Cost (MBBS in Russia students)






























City



Cost of Monthly Rent per Student (Shared Accommodation)



Ufa



5,000 – 9,000 Rubles



Kazan



7,000 – 12,000 Rubles



Volgograd



5,000 – 8,500 Rubles



Kursk



6,000 – 10,000 Rubles



Moscow



12,000 – 20,000 Rubles



With sharing among 2 or 3 batchmates, apartment living becomes cost-effective, particularly in cheaper MBBS cities in Russia like Volgograd, Orenburg, and Ufa.

What Do Experienced MBBS Students in Russia Recommend?

There is a popular, recurring plan that nearly all students who have had several years of MBBS in Russia recommend to newcomers.

Years 1 & 2 Hostel: Friends, settle into the hostel, get to know your fellow students, and get used to the Russian weather and lifestyle. The hostel is the starting point.

Years 3 and above: Think about an apartment. When you've adjusted to life, know the city, and have friends to go with, and if you prefer the privacy, make the move. It'll be even more of a Russian MBBS experience.

This plan makes sure you get the two sides of being on an economical MBBS in Russia journey.

Life in MBBS in Russia: Common Costs Beyond Accommodation


































Items



Approx. Monthly Amount (in Rubles)



Food



2,500 – 5,000 Rubles



Transport



500 – 1,500 Rubles



Stationery and Study Books



500 – 1,000 Rubles



Personal and General Expenses



1,000 – 2,000 Rubles



Entertainment and Outdoor Visits



500 – 1,500 Rubles



Overall Total (Without Accommodation)



5,000 – 11,000 Rubles



This and the hostel or apartment rent would total up for most students between 12000 and 22000 rubles for a month for an MBBS in Russia, which makes an MBBS in Russia a pocket-friendly study worldwide.
